The Global Markets Pre-Trade IT team is dedicated to delivering reliable and timely IT solutions for the Global Macro (Rates, FX), Equity/Securities Lending, and Credit businesses. This team is actively involved in all phases of application development, including user needs gathering, analysis, design, implementation, delivery, support, and maintenance, all within an agile framework.
One of the primary applications supported by our team is an in-house solution that facilitates the booking, pricing, electronic trading, and TRACE reporting of Bonds, CLOs, Repos, Loans, and Interest Rate Futures. This is a global application that involves collaboration between teams at headquarters and our international branches.
